Alumni Matters

Alumna, alumnus, alumnae, alumni: alumna refers to a woman; alumnae is the plural. Alumnus refers to a man; alumni is the plural, also used for a group of men and women:

the alumni board, the alumni association, reunions, Portland chapter

not:

the Alumni Board, the Alumni Association, Reunions, Portland Chapter

Class names: lowercase is preferred. Example:

class of '89

Class years: no comma between name and class year, or after the class year. The class year apostrophe is formed in Word by the combined commands shift-option-right bracket (]):

Reed alumna Barbara Ehrenreich '63.

not:

Reed Alumna Barbara Ehrenreich, '63
